Deep learning model for plant disease detection based on visual analysis of leaf infestation area
The European Physical Journal Special Topics · 14 Jan 2025 · 10.1140/epjs/s11734-024-01450-6
Abstract
The article considers modern methods based on deep learning for solving the problem of plant disease recognition. A comparative analysis of some existing methods is carried out. A modified neural network model is created that allows to surpass existing methods in recognition accuracy and memory costs. Using the VGG16 architecture, a modified convolutional model is developed using Keras. The dataset used were images of plants—tomato leaves, both healthy and diseased. A computational experiment was carried out in comparison with such architectures as VGG16, ResNet-50, and EfficientNet-85. The proposed model allows to detect plant diseases with the best results in computations and accuracy.
